What Is Cold Laser Therapy?
Cold laser therapy, additionally called low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a non-invasive therapy that uses certain wavelengths of light to advertise recovery and minimize discomfort.
This innovative technique targets harmed cells, stimulating mobile activity without causing injury or discomfort. You might find it useful for various problems, including joint pain, muscular tissue injuries, and inflammation.
Unlike conventional laser therapies, cold laser treatment doesn't create warm, making it safe and comfy for clients. Treatments commonly last between 5 to 30 minutes, relying on the area being addressed.
You might obtain several sessions for optimum outcomes, and many people report feeling alleviation after just a few therapies.

Device of Action
Laser treatment employs low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ular procedures. When you get treatment, the light penetrates your skin and is soaked up by your cells, especially the mitochondria. This absorption boosts ATP manufacturing, which is the energy currency of your cells. Therefore, your cells can repair themselves more quickly and successfully.
Furthermore, cold laser therapy advertises increased blood circulation, supplying even more oxygen and nutrients to broken cells. It also helps reduce swelling and discomfort by regulating the release of numerous biochemical compounds.
Therapy Process Review
When you undertake cold laser therapy, a qualified specialist guides low-level laser light onto the targeted location of your body. This non-invasive procedure commonly lasts in between 15 to thirty minutes, depending upon your condition and the location being treated. You might feel a gentle warmth or prickling experience, however the procedure is generally pain-free.
The laser light permeates your skin, stimulating cellular activity and advertising recovery. Procedure are normally arranged numerous times a week for optimum outcomes, and you could see renovations after just a couple of treatments.
After each session, you can typically resume your daily tasks with no downtime, making it a hassle-free choice for those seeking remedy for pain or inflammation.

Security and Negative Effects of Cold Laser Therapy
While cold laser treatment is usually thought about safe, it's vital to know prospective adverse effects. The majority of people experience marginal pain, however you could see short-term skin irritation or an experience of warmth during treatment.
Hardly ever, relevant web site report headaches or dizzi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have certain clinical conditions, review this with your doctor before beginning therapy.
Likewise, guarantee the practitioner is certified and makes use of FDA-approved devices. Although significant adverse effects are unusual, it's wise to monitor your body's feedback after each session.
If you experience any unusual signs and symptoms, do not think twice to reach out to your physician for assistance. Being educated assists make sure a favorable experience with cold laser therapy.
